Section 4 - Maintenance and Servicing

The 7360V Curing Chamber was designed to require little maintenance and servicing. The
following guidelines are recommended to help insure years of trouble free service. In the
event a problem occurs, a troubleshooting guide is listed following the maintenance
guidelines.

Maintenance

Make certain that the plug and cylinder threads are clean and well lubricated with Moly
grease or other high temperature lubricant.
Check the internal plug O-ring periodically for cuts, tears, or deterioration. Replace if any of
these are evident.
Note: You must install a new O-ring after any test in which the temperature exceeds
350°F/177°C.
Clean all cement out of the bottom of the cylinder.
